Human Superoxide Dismutase 1 (SOD1), Active Protein
Human Superoxide Dismutase 1 (SOD1), Active Protein is a purified Prokaryotic Protein. Purity: >90% by SDS-PAGE. Host: E. coli. Endotoxin Level: <1.0EU per 1ug, by the LAL method. Species: Human (Homo sapiens) . Target Name: Superoxide Dismutase 1 (SOD1) . Target Synonyms: ALS; ALS1; IPOA; Superoxide Dismutase 1, Soluble;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is 1, Adult; Superoxide dismutase [Cu-Zn]. Accession Number: P00441. Expression Region: Ala2~Gln154. Tag Info: N-terminal His Tag. Theoretical MW: 19kDa. Buffer: PBS, pH7.4, containing 0.01% SKL, 5% Trehalose. Storage: -20°C. Avoid repeated freeze/thaw cycles. Restrictions: For Research Use Only. Not for use in diagnostic procedures.
